In February 2024, the Information Commissioner's Office (ICO) approved an official GDPR certification standard, LOCS:23.

This new standard has been specifically developed to ensure law firms, barristers’ chambers and suppliers to the legal sector meet their UK GDPR obligations, and evidence to clients that their data is properly and legally protected.

As a government backed standard LOSC:23 is likely to become the minimum standard of GDPR compliance expected by clients, government bodies and regulators soon.
